The word “citations” can be traced back literally thousands of years to the Latin word “citare” meaning “to summon, urge, call; put in sudden motion, call forward; rouse, excite.”. The word then took on its more modern meaning and relevance to writing ...The Chicago Manual of Style (17th edition) contains guidelines for two styles of citation: notes and bibliography and author-date.. Notes and bibliography is the most common type of Chicago style citation, and the main focus of this article. It is widely used in the humanities. If you’re taking a class in the liberal arts, you usually have to follow this format w... When using APA format, follow the author-date method of in-text citation. This means that the author's last name and the year of publication for the source should appear in the text, like, for example, (Jones, 1998). Separate citations with a semi-colon. Cases Give the party names, followed by the neutral citation, followed by the Law Reports citation (eg AC, Ch, QB). If there is no neutral citation, give the Law Reports citation followed by the court in brackets. If the case is …

If you cite a paper from arXiv, you should include information that will explicitly say that this is an arXiv preprint, and give readers some obvious way to find the paper on arXiv. At the heart of Turabian is the idea that ...Add a comment. 1. @misc is the best solution. Just specify archivePrefix="arXiv", and the eprint id, as in Mateus's answer. @article shows a blank In: field, and @unpublished doesn't show an arXiv id, but @misc shows author, title, year, and arXiv id. Include an in-text citation when you refer to, summarize, paraphrase, or quote from another source. For every in-text citation in your paper, there must be a corresponding entry in your reference list. APA in-text citation style uses the author's last name and the year of publication, for example: (Field, 2005).

In-text citations are quick references to your sources. In Harvard referencing, you use the author’s surname and the date of publication in brackets. Up to three authors are included in a Harvard in-text citation. If the source has more than three authors, include the first author followed by ‘ et al. ‘.
